Product Introduction

Overview

The TJA1051T/E/1J is a high-speed CAN transceiver produced by NXP USA Inc., designed to provide an interface between a Controller Area Network (CAN) protocol controller and the physical two-wire CAN bus. This transceiver is part of the third generation of high-speed CAN transceivers from NXP Semiconductors, offering significant improvements over earlier models like the TJA1050. It is specifically tailored for high-speed CAN applications in the automotive industry, ensuring reliable communication at data rates up to 5 Mbit/s in the CAN FD fast phase, as defined by 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-5 standards.

Key Specifications

Parameter Conditions Min Typ Max Unit
VCC supply voltage 4.5 5.5 V
VIO supply voltage 2.8 5.5 V
Vuvd(VCC) undervoltage detection voltage 3.5 4.5 V
ICC supply current (Normal mode, bus recessive) 2.5 5 10 mA
ICC supply current (Normal mode, bus dominant) 20 50 70 mA
IESD electrostatic discharge voltage IEC 61000-4-2 at pins CANH and CANL -8 +8 kV
VCANH voltage on pin CANH -58 +58 V
VCANL voltage on pin CANL -58 +58 V
Tvj virtual junction temperature -40 +150 °C

Key Features

  • 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-5 compliant
  • Timing guaranteed for data rates up to 5 Mbit/s in the CAN FD fast phase
  • Suitable for 12 V and 24 V systems
  • Low ElectroMagnetic Emission (EME) and high ElectroMagnetic Immunity (EMI)
  • Ideal passive behavior to the CAN bus when the supply voltage is off
  • TJA1051T/3 and TJA1051TK/3 can be interfaced directly to microcontrollers with supply voltages from 3 V to 5 V
  • EN input on TJA1051T/E allows the microcontroller to switch the transceiver to a very low-current Off mode
  • Available in SO8 package or leadless HVSON8 package (3.0 mm × 3.0 mm) with improved Automated Optical Inspection (AOI) capability
  • Dark green product (halogen free and Restriction of Hazardous Substances (RoHS) compliant)
  • AEC-Q100 qualified
  • High ElectroStatic Discharge (ESD) handling capability on the bus pins
  • Bus pins protected against transients in automotive environments
  • Transmit Data (TXD) dominant time-out function
  • Undervoltage detection on pins VCC and VIO
  • Thermally protected

Applications

The TJA1051T/E/1J is primarily designed for high-speed CAN applications in the automotive industry. It is suitable for various automotive systems that require reliable and high-speed communication, such as engine control units, transmission control units, and other vehicle network nodes that do not require a standby mode with wake-up capability via the bus.

Q & A

  1. What is the TJA1051T/E/1J used for?

    The TJA1051T/E/1J is a high-speed CAN transceiver that provides an interface between a Controller Area Network (CAN) protocol controller and the physical two-wire CAN bus.

  2. What are the key improvements of the TJA1051 over the TJA1050?

    The TJA1051 offers improved ElectroMagnetic Compatibility (EMC) and ElectroStatic Discharge (ESD) performance, along with enhanced slope control and high DC handling capability on the bus pins.

  3. What are the operating modes of the TJA1051?

    The TJA1051 supports two operating modes: Normal and Silent, selected via pin S. An additional Off mode is supported in the TJA1051T/E via pin EN.

  4. What is the significance of the EN pin in the TJA1051T/E?

    The EN pin on the TJA1051T/E allows the microcontroller to switch the transceiver to a very low-current Off mode.

  5. What are the package options for the TJA1051?

    The TJA1051 is available in SO8 and leadless HVSON8 packages (3.0 mm × 3.0 mm).

  6. Is the TJA1051 compliant with automotive standards?

    Yes, the TJA1051 is compliant with 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-5 standards.

  7. What is the maximum data rate supported by the TJA1051?

    The TJA1051 supports data rates up to 5 Mbit/s in the CAN FD fast phase.

  8. What is the voltage range for the VCC supply?

    The VCC supply voltage range is from 4.5 V to 5.5 V.

  9. What is the significance of the VIO pin in the TJA1051T/3 and TJA1051TK/3?

    The VIO pin allows for direct interfacing to microcontrollers with supply voltages from 3 V to 5 V.

  10. Is the TJA1051 environmentally friendly?

    Yes, the TJA1051 is a dark green product, which means it is halogen free and compliant with the Restriction of Hazardous Substances (RoHS).

  11. What is the qualification standard for the TJA1051?

    The TJA1051 is AEC-Q100 qualified.
